The 2004 film (Czech title: Horem pádem ), directed by Jan Hřebejk , is a tragi-comic social satire set in post-Communist Prague. The film explores themes of racism , immigration , globalization , and the universal search for identity through several intersecting storylines. 🎥 Plot Summary
Two smugglers of illegal immigrants find a baby left behind in their truck. They sell the infant to a shady pawnshop, and it eventually ends up with Miluska and Frantisek , a childless couple. Frantisek is a former soccer hooligan who must confront his own xenophobia when he realizes the child he has come to love is of a different race. Up and Down(2004)
